Sample questions

Q1. Which nerve innervates the supraspinatus muscle?

Answer: The suprascapular nerve (C5–C6), a branch of the upper trunk of the brachial plexus.

Q2. What is the primary action of the iliopsoas?

Answer: Hip flexion, with contributions to lumbar spine stabilization and slight external rotation.
